MOIST YELLOW CAKE RECIPE



Moist Yellow Cake Recipe image

Moist yellow cake recipe that gives you perfect results every time! No more wondering how your cake will turn out -- this recipe is easy and delicious! And you can use it for a layer cake or cupcakes.

Provided by Lucy Brewer

Categories     Cakes

Time 1h15m

Number Of Ingredients 11

4 whole large eggs, room temperature
2 large egg yolks, room temperature
1 cup buttermilk, room temperature
3 teaspoons vanilla extract
3 cups cake flour, sifted
1 teaspoon baking soda
2 teaspoons baking powder
¼ teaspoon salt
2 cups granulated sugar
12 tablespoons unsalted butter, diced, softened
1/3 cup vegetable oil

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°.
  • Butter and flour three 9-inch cake pans, then line each pan with parchment paper. Spray and flour the parchment paper, shaking out the excess flour.
  • In a large measuring cup or pourable bowl, add the buttermilk, eggs, egg yolks, and vanilla and beat with a fork until blended. Set aside.
  • Place the sifted cake fl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t, and sugar in the bowl of a stand mixer and blend on low for about 30 seconds.
  • With the mixer running on low, add the butter, one piece at a time. Pour in the vegetable oil. Mix until the flour and butter clump together and appear pebbly, about 30 seconds after the vegetable oil has been added.
  • Pour in a little more than half of the buttermilk-egg mixture and mix on the lowest speed until blended, about 10 seconds. Increase the speed to medium-high and mix until starting to appear light and fluffy, about 1 minute. Without turning off the mixer, add the remaining buttermilk mixture in a slow stream.
  • Stop the mixer and scrape the sides and bottom of the bowl, then beat at medium-high speed for about 15 seconds until well-mixed.
  • Pour batter evenly into the prepared cake pans and bake until golden brown, 20-25 minutes.
  • Cool pans on a wire rack for 10 minutes, then run a knife around the edges to loosen. Invert each layer onto a plate, peel off the parchment, then invert back onto the wire rack. Allow to cool completely before frosting.

MOIST YELLOW CAKE



Moist Yellow Cake image

This is moist and delicious yellow cake that will be a favorite in your recipe file. It calls for 24 servings so it's a good start on a wedding cake. For other occasions you could make one 9x13 and 12 cupcakes. I'm sure you will like this recipe!

Provided by Isaiah

Categories     Desserts     Cakes     Yellow Cake Recipes

Time 50m

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 cup butter
2 ½ cups white sugar
3 eggs
1 ½ teaspoons vanilla extract
2 ½ cups buttermilk
3 ¾ cups all-purpose flour
2 ¼ teaspoons baking powder
2 ½ teaspoons baking soda

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ease and flour two 9x13 inch pans. Sift together the flour, baking powder and baking soda. Set aside.
  • In a large bowl, cream together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la. Beat in the flour mixture alternately with the buttermilk, mixing just until incorporated. Pour batter into prepared pans.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 35 to 40 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center of the cake comes out clean. Allow to cool.

MOIST MOIST YELLOW CAKE



Moist Moist Yellow Cake image

Make and share this Moist Moist Yellow Cake recipe from Food.com.

Provided by NurseGirl2004

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h

Yield 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 1/2 cups flour
1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on baking soda
3/4 cup butter, at room temperature
1 3/4 cups sugar
2 teaspoons vanilla
3 egg yolks
3 eggs
1 cup milk

Steps:

  • Heat the oven to 350°F Coat 9x13 pan with butter and flour, and tap out any excess flour. Set aside.
  • Combine flour, baking powder, salt, and baking soda in a small bowl and whisk break up any lumps. Set aside.
  • Place butter in the bowl and mix on medium-high speed until fluffy and light in color, about 3 minutes. Add sugar and vanilla, and continue to beat another 5 minutes. Add yolks one at a time, letting each incorporate fully before adding the next. Scrape down the sides of the bowl.
  • Add whole eggs in the same manner, allowing 1 minute between additions. Scrape down the sides of the bowl and the paddle.
  • Add 1/2 of the flour mixture, and turn the mixer to low speed, mixing until the flour is just incorporated. Add 1/2 of the milk, and mix until just incorporated. Continue with remaining flour mixture and milk, until all ingredients are incorporated and smooth.
  • Pour in prepared pan and bake until cake edges slightly pull away from the pan and a cake tester inserted in the center comes out dry with just a few crumbs, about 35 to 40 minutes.
  • Remove the pan from the oven and let cool on a wire rack, about 10 to 15 minutes. Run a knife around the perimeter of cake, and turn out onto the rack to cool completely (at least 1 1/2 hours) before frosting.

GRANDMA'S MOIST CAKE



Grandma's Moist Cake image

This very moist yellow cake recipe comes from my boyfriend's grandmother. We usually serve it with chocolate buttermilk icing.

Provided by Patricia Taylor

Categories     Desserts     Cakes     Yellow Cake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 cup butter
2 cups white sugar
4 eggs
2 ½ cups self-rising flour
1 cup milk
1 tablespo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ease and flour three 8 inch pans.
  • In a medium bowl, cream together the butter and sugar. Beat in the eggs, one at a time. Combine the milk and vanilla, add alternately to the creamed mixture with the flour, ending with the flour. Mix only as much as necessary. Pour into the prepared pans.
  • Bake for 15 to 20 minutes in the preheated oven. Cake will pull away from the sides of the pan slightly when done. Allow cakes to cool in the pans for a few minutes before removing to wire racks to cool completely.

LIGHT AND FLUFFY YELLOW CAKE



Light and Fluffy Yellow Cake image

Whipped egg whites are the secret behind this airy, moist cake. Decorate each layer with our Chocolate Frosting for a spectacular birthday or special-occasion dessert.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Dessert & Treats Recipes     Cake Recipes

Yield Makes two 9-inch cakes

Number Of Ingredients 9

8 ounces (2 sticks) unsalted butter, softened, plus more for pans
3 cups cake flour, plus more for dusting
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
2 cups sugar
4 large eggs, separated (egg whites whipped to stiff peaks)
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1 cup buttermilk, room temperature

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Butter and line two 9-inch round cake pans with parchment. Butter parchment, then flour pans, tapping out excess. Set aside.
  • Whisk together fl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t in a medium bowl; set aside. Put butter and sugar in the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ment; cream on medium-high speed until pale, 2 to 3 minutes. On medium speed, add eggs yolks one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Add vanilla and mix, scraping down sides of bowl. On low speed, add the flour mixture in three batches, alternating with two batches of buttermilk. Fold in egg whites. Stir with a rubber spatula until the batter is evenly blended.
  • Divide batter between pans. Smooth the top of each layer with a small offset spatula.
  • Bake until a cake tester inserted into centers comes out clean, 30 to 35 minutes.
  • Remove from oven and let cool in pans on wire racks, 20 minutes. Run a knife around edges of cakes to loosen. Invert cakes from pans. Peel off parchment from cakes. Reinvert and let cool completely on racks.

SUPER-MOIST YELLOW CAKE WITH RICH CHOCOLATE FROSTING



Super-Moist Yellow Cake With Rich Chocolate Frosting image

This easy yellow cake recipe yields a cake that's remarkably fluffy and moist.

Provided by Genevieve Yam

Time 1h45m

Yield Makes two 9"-diameter cakes

Number Of Ingredients 15

¾ cup (1½ sticks) unsalted butter, room temperature, cut into pieces, plus more for pans
3 cups (345 g) cake flour
¾ cup (150 g) granulated sugar
1 Tbsp. baking powder
1 tsp. baking soda
1 tsp. Diamond Crystal or ½ tsp. Morton kosher salt
4 large eggs, room temperature
2 large egg yolks, room temperature
1½ cups buttermilk, room temperature
1 Tbsp. vanilla extract
4 cups (440 g) powdered sugar
1½ cups (126 g) unsweetened Dutch-process cocoa powder
1½ cups (3 sticks) unsalted butter, room temperature
¾ tsp. Diamond Crystal or ½ tsp. Morton kosher salt
¼ cup plus 2 Tbsp. (or more) buttermilk, room temperature

Steps:

  • Place a rack in middle of oven; preheat to 350°. Butter two 9"-diameter cake pans and line each bottom with a parchment paper round; butter parchment. Using an electric mixer on low speed, mix 3 cups (345 g) cake flour, ¾ cup (150 g) granulated sugar, 1 Tbsp. baking powder, 1 tsp. baking soda, and 1 tsp. Diamond Crystal or ½ tsp. Morton kosher salt in a large bowl until combined, about 30 seconds.
  • With the motor running, add ¾ cup (1½ sticks) unsalted butter, room temperature, cut into pieces, then increase speed to medium and beat until butter is in small pieces and mixture looks sandy, about 3 minutes.
  • Turn off mixer and add 4 large eggs, room temperature, 2 large egg yolks, room temperature, 1½ cups buttermilk, room temperature, and 1 Tbsp. vanilla extract. Beat on medium-high speed until pale yellow and fluffy, about 1 minute (be careful not to overmix batter). Divide batter between prepared pans and smooth tops with an offset spatula.
  • Bake cakes until tops are golden and spring back when gently pressed, 30-35 minutes. Transfer pans to a wire rack and let cakes cool in pans 15 minutes. Run a small knife or offset spatula around inside of pans to loosen cakes, then turn out onto rack. Remove parchment and let cakes cool completely, about 1 hour.
  • While the cakes are cooling, sift 4 cups (440 g) powdered sugar and 1½ cups (126 g) unsweetened Dutch-process cocoa powder into a medium bowl. Using an electric mixer with clean beaters (or paddle) on medium speed, beat 1½ cups (3 sticks) unsalted butter, room temperature, and ¾ tsp. Diamond Crystal or ½ tsp. Morton kosher salt in a large bowl until creamy, about 4 minutes. Add half of dry ingredients and beat on low speed until incorporated. Add remaining dry ingredients and ¼ cup plus 2 Tbsp. buttermilk, room temperature, and beat until thoroughly combined. If frosting is too stiff, thin with more buttermilk (1-2 Tbsp.) until it reaches a spreadable consistency.
  • Using a large serrated knife, slice domed tops from cakes. Place 1 layer on a large plate or cake stand and spread a thick layer of frosting on top with an offset spatula. Place second cake layer on top and generously frost top and sides of cake with remaining buttercream. Smooth sides and create decorative swoops and swirls on the top.
